West Grey Library offers lifelong learning – and fun!

West Grey Library calendar - April 2024

West Grey Library’s April roster runs the gamut, with programs and activities for all West Grey adults with an interest in keeping their minds sharp and their interests growing.

Highlights this month include: a Trivia Night fundraiser at the Country Corner, Tuesday, April 16, starting at 7:30 pm (come early if you’re eating). $10 per person, teams of two-six.

A special session on Indigenous culture, part of the Library’s Biindigin (‘Come In’) series, takes place on Saturday, April 20 at the Durham Town Hall, starting at 1 pm. The Path Ahead – Rebuilding Our Canoe, hosted by the Library’s elder-in-residence Diane Owen, explores the effects of residential schools and offers tools to repair, heal and move forward. $15 materials fee.

And in honour of Earth Day, the Library is hosting homesteaders Bryce and Misty for Making Your Home More Eco-Friendly, also on Saturday, April 20 — this one takes place at Durham Branch, starting at 1 pm. And the Master Gardeners return one last time this season for Pollinator-Friendly Gardening on Wednesday, April 24 at 2:30 pm.

Meditation continues with Alison — the spring session this month focuses on compassion meditations. Each Saturday in April (session on the 20 at the Durham Town Hall), 10:30 am.
